# Who to Contact: Catalog Cache Invalidation

The Stockmere product catalog uses a write-through cache with event-driven invalidation. If you are reviewing code that touches product mutations, confirm it emits an invalidation event via the catalog bus — silent writes cause stale listings for up to an hour. TTL fallbacks exist but should not be relied on. Schema changes to invalidation events require sign-off from the catalog platform team. For review questions or to request sign-off, use the address below.

escalation mailbox, hadug-bajog: sormir@norvalabs.internal

## Step 4: Verify artifact before deploy

Resizely CLI ships as a single static binary. Batch resize jobs run with no network access; confirm the sandbox flag is set in the service manifest. All releases are built on the Fennwick CI cluster from tagged commits only. Reviewers should diff the SBOM against the prior release and confirm no new dynamic dependencies. Checksums are published alongside each tarball. Verify the detached signature on the binary using the current release signing key, shown below.

signing key of bagap-yawep = bky13_TbfT6ZMUoGJo2

## Vendoring Fonts — Glyphwright Release Steps

Before tagging a Glyphwright release, confirm that all third-party typefaces are mirrored into the `vendor/fonts` tree and that license manifests match the upstream snapshot. Never pull fonts at build time; the release must be reproducible offline. The resolver reads its paths and checksum policy from the values below.

service settings:
[julix]
host = julix.sivrelcloud.internal
user = julix_svc
database = julix_prod

## Runbook: Zero-Downtime Schema Migration (Corvid Orders DB)

Migrations on the Corvid orders database must follow expand-contract: add new columns as nullable, enable dual writes, backfill in batches of 10k, then verify parity before dropping old columns. Never combine expand and contract in one release. Monitor replication lag throughout; abort if it exceeds threshold. The migration runner should be started with the configuration below.

config for kafof-bawef:
holath:
  log_level: debug
  metrics_host: metrics.holath.qorvelsys.internal
  pin: 2191
  pool_size: 32